Share a message of light, hope and comfort with our Yellow Roses Service Arrangement, thoughtfully hand-crafted by Flower Delivery Soho. Featuring premium, large-headed yellow roses, this elegant display offers a warm and uplifting tribute during times of loss or remembrance. The sunny hue of the roses symbolises friendship, support and optimism, making this arrangement a gentle way to brighten a difficult day.

Perfect for funerals, memorial services or as a sympathy gift, each rose is carefully prepared with its natural guard petals intact to protect the delicate inner blooms in transit. Once received, these outer petals can easily be removed to reveal the full beauty of the arrangement.
